rayzor

diff src/scene.cc @ 15:be616b58df99

continued the renderer slightly
author John Tsiombikas <nuclear@member.fsf.org>
date Sun, 13 Apr 2014 09:54:36 +0300
parents a9a948809c6f
children 79609d482762
line diff
     1.1 --- a/src/scene.cc	Sun Apr 13 08:06:21 2014 +0300
     1.2 +++ b/src/scene.cc	Sun Apr 13 09:54:36 2014 +0300
     1.3 @@ -125,6 +125,16 @@
     1.4  	return cameras[idx];
     1.5  }
     1.6  
     1.7 +void Scene::set_active_camera(Camera *cam)
     1.8 +{
     1.9 +	active_cam = cam;
    1.10 +}
    1.11 +
    1.12 +Camera *Scene::get_active_camera() const
    1.13 +{
    1.14 +	return active_cam;
    1.15 +}
    1.16 +
    1.17  void Scene::draw() const
    1.18  {
    1.19  	if(active_cam) {